@mrcatdoc11 жыл бұрын
this is a two cylinder engine with 4 pistons and two crankshafts. the piston come together in the center in each cylinder to make the compression ,the cylinder head sits on top of the block in the center with the intake and exhaust valves

@mrcatdoc4 жыл бұрын
I first made them to plan, I felt they did not carry enough energy so I made them bigger. Also you should make a decent sized intake plenum the air fuel will mix better and you should get much better throttle response. Also you need a bigger cooling system and you need to pin the heat shafts better than what the plans call for
